次の方法で共有


IDataProtector インターフェイス

定義

データ保護サービスを提供できるインターフェイス。

public interface class IDataProtector : Microsoft::AspNetCore::DataProtection::IDataProtectionProvider
public interface IDataProtector : Microsoft.AspNetCore.DataProtection.IDataProtectionProvider
type IDataProtector = interface
    interface IDataProtectionProvider
Public Interface IDataProtector
Implements IDataProtectionProvider
派生
実装

メソッド

名前 説明
CreateProtector(String)

特定の目的に IDataProtector を作成します。

(継承元 IDataProtectionProvider)
Protect(Byte[])

暗号化によってプレーンテキスト データの一部が保護されます。

Unprotect(Byte[])

暗号化によって保護されたデータの一部の保護を解除します。

拡張メソッド

名前 説明
CreateProtector(IDataProtectionProvider, IEnumerable<String>)

目的の一覧を指定して IDataProtector を作成します。

CreateProtector(IDataProtectionProvider, String, String[])

目的の一覧を指定して IDataProtector を作成します。

Protect(IDataProtector, String)

暗号化によってプレーンテキスト データの一部が保護されます。

ToTimeLimitedDataProtector(IDataProtector)

ペイロードを有限の有効期間で保護できるように、 IDataProtectorITimeLimitedDataProtector に変換します。

Unprotect(IDataProtector, String)

暗号化によって保護されたデータの一部の保護を解除します。

適用対象